The COPD Score in 54234, Sister Bay, Wisconsin is 53 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

89.95 percent of the population in 54234 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 85.87 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 2.31 percent of the residents in 54234 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 0.93 members with about 2.01 cars available per household.

An estimate of 93.50 percent of the residents in 54234 has some form of health insurance. 54.76 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 74.58 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 54234 would have to travel an average of 26.27 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Door County Medical Center .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 54234, Sister Bay, Wisconsin.

As of , an estimate of 2,124 residents live in 54234 with a median age of 59.7 years. 15.54 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 40.21 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 38.12 percent of the residents in 54234 is currently married, and 11.61 percent of the population has never been married.

The monthly median household income in 54234 is $5,383.58.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 54234 is approximately $1,016. The median household spends about 18.87 percent of their income on housing.

COPD is a progressive lung disease that makes it difficult to breathe. It encompasses various lung conditions, such as emphysema and chronic bronchitis. People with COPD often require regular medical attention and access to healthcare facilities. Missing appointments can have serious health implications and lead to increased financial costs due to exacerbations of the disease.
